Understanding Hreflang: Benefits, Advantages, and How to Use It
Search engines are informed about the language and location of the content on websites via a tag called Hreflang. The use of hreflang can improve the accuracy of search engine results for your website, which could ultimately lead to more visitors and a better user experience. In this article, we'll go over what hreflang is, why it's useful, and how to utilize it.
INCREASE YOUR SALES , TRAFFIC AND CONVERSION BY 80%

By Musah
Updated February 2023
What is hreflang?
Hreflang: The Ultimate Guide to Managing Multilingual and Multi-Regional Websites
Introduction
Maintaining a multilingual or regional website can be challenging, particularly when it comes to optimizing content for search engines. One essential aspect of this process is using correct hreflang tags which tell search engines the relationship between different language versions of your content. In this comprehensive guide, we’ll define what hreflang is, how to use it effectively, and some common mistakes to avoid. At 1stPage Boost, we understand the significance of properly managing multilingual websites and can assist you in navigating these complexities so you maximize your search visibility.
1. What is Hreflang?
Hreflang is an HTML attribute used to indicate the language and regional targeting of a webpage. Introduced by Google in 2011, hreflang tags provide webmasters with a way to communicate the relationship between various language versions of their content. By using hreflang tags, search engines such as Google can better determine which version of a page to display to users based on their language preferences and location, creating a better user experience and improved search performance overall.
2. Why Use Hreflang?
There are several reasons to use hreflang tags on your multilingual or multi-regional website:
A. Serve the Correct Language Version
Hreflang helps search engines determine which language version of a page is most pertinent to an individual, ensuring they receive the appropriate content based on their language preferences and location.
B. Prevent Duplicate Content Issues
By specifying the relationship between different language versions of your content, search engines can better comprehend that these pages do not duplicate content but rather cater to distinct audiences.
C. Improve SEO Performance
When search engines have a clear understanding of the language and regional targeting of your content, they can more effectively index and rank your website for users searching in different languages and regions.
3. How to Implement Hreflang Tags
There are three main methods for implementing hreflang tags on your website:
A. HTML Link Element
Add a link element to the head section of each language version of your webpage, using the “rel” attribute with the value “alternate” and the “hreflang” attribute with the appropriate language and region code. This method is recommended for smaller websites with a limited number of language versions.
Example:
<link rel="alternate" hreflang="en" href="https://example.com/en/">
<link rel="alternate" hreflang="es" href="https://example.com/es/">
B. HTTP Header
For non-HTML content (such as PDFs), you can include the hreflang attribute in the HTTP header of the content. This method is less common but useful for content types that don’t support HTML tags.
Example:
Link: <https://example.com/en/>; rel="alternate"; hreflang="en"
Link: <https://example.com/es/>; rel="alternate"; hreflang="es"
C. XML Sitemap
For larger websites with numerous language versions, including hreflang information in your XML sitemap can be a more efficient approach. This method allows you to manage all hreflang information in one centralized location and makes it easier for search engines to process.
Example:
<url>
<loc>https://example.com/en/</loc>
<xhtml:link rel="alternate" hreflang="en" href="https://example.com/en/" />
<xhtml:link rel="alternate" hreflang="es" href="https://example.com/es/" />
</url>
4. Hreflang Best Practices
To ensure the proper implementation of hreflang
tags on your website, follow these best practices:
A. Use the Correct Language and Region Codes
Ensure that you’re using the correct language and region codes in your hreflang tags, as specified by the ISO 639-1 and ISO 3166-1 Alpha 2 standards, respectively. For example, use “en-US” for English content targeting the United States, and “es-ES” for Spanish content targeting Spain.
B. Include Self-Referential Hreflang Tags
Each language version of a page should include an hreflang tag to help search engines recognize that the page is part of an established group of related language versions and should be evaluated alongside them when selecting which version to display to users.
C. Implement Bidirectional Linking
Ensure that all language versions of a page link to one another using hreflang tags. This bidirectional linking helps search engines understand the relationship between the different language versions and makes it easier for them to index and serve the correct content to users.
D. Use the “x-default” Hreflang Tag
If your website has a default language version that should be served to users whose language preferences aren’t explicitly targeted, use the “x-default” hreflang tag to specify this version.
Example:
<link rel="alternate" hreflang="x-default" href="https://example.com/">
5. Common Hreflang Mistakes to Avoid
When implementing hreflang tags, be mindful of these common mistakes:
A. Incorrect Language or Region Codes
Using incorrect language or region codes can lead to your hreflang tags being ignored by search engines, resulting in the wrong content being served to users. Always double-check your codes against the ISO 639-1 and ISO 3166-1 Alpha 2 standards.
B. Incomplete Hreflang Implementation
Failing to include hreflang tags for all language versions of a page, or not implementing bidirectional linking, can cause confusion for search engines and lead to suboptimal search performance. Make sure to properly implement hreflang tags on all relevant pages and maintain consistency across your website.
C. Not Handling Redirects Properly
If you use redirects for language or region-specific content, ensure that your hreflang tags still point to the correct destination URLs. Incorrectly handling redirects can result in search engines ignoring your hreflang tags and serving the wrong content to users.
Conclusion
Implementing hreflang tags correctly is essential for optimizing the search performance of your multilingual or regional website. By adhering to best practices and avoiding common mistakes, search engines will recognize and serve up appropriate content according to each language version. At 1stPage Boost, our team of SEO specialists can assist you in navigating hreflang implementation so that your visibility across multiple languages and regions increases significantly.
FAQs
1. What is the purpose of hreflang tags?
Hreflang tags are used to indicate the language and regional targeting of a webpage, helping search engines determine which version of the page to display to users based on their language preferences and location.
2. What are the different methods for implementing hreflang tags?
Hreflang tags can be implemented using HTML link elements, HTTP headers, or XML sitemaps.
3. How can I ensure my hreflang implementation is correct?
Adhere to best practices such as using the correct language and region codes, including self-referential hreflang tags, implementing bidirectional linking, and using “x-default” hreflang tags when applicable.
4. What are some common hreflang mistakes to avoid?
Common hreflang mistakes include using incorrect language or region codes,
incomplete hreflang implementation, and not handling redirects properly.
5. How can hreflang tags improve my website’s SEO performance?
Hreflang tags can improve your website’s SEO performance by aiding search engines in understanding the relationship between different language versions of content, ensuring users receive the correct version based on their language preferences and location, and avoiding duplicate content issues.
6. Can I use hreflang tags for non-HTML content?
Yes, for non-HTML content such as PDFs, you can include the hreflang attribute in the HTTP header of the content.
7. How do I choose the correct language and region codes for my hreflang tags?
Use the ISO 639-1 standard for language codes and the ISO 3166-1 Alpha 2 standard for region codes when specifying the language and regional targeting of your content in hreflang tags.
8. Do I need to use hreflang tags if my website is only available in one language?
No, hreflang tags are primarily used for multilingual and multi-regional websites. If your website is only available in one language, you don’t need to implement hreflang tags.
9. How does the “x-default” hreflang tag work?
The “x-default” hreflang tag is used to indicate a default language version of a page that should be served to users whose preferences aren’t specifically targeted by your website. This helps guarantee a better user experience for those visitors who may not speak one of the languages you’ve specifically targeted.
10. Can I use hreflang tags to target different regions with the same language?
Yes, hreflang tags can be used to target different regions with the same language. For example, you can use “en-US” to target English speakers in the United States and “en-GB” to target English speakers in the United Kingdom.
Some of the SEO tools we use

Our Expertise

